Azo dye is prepared by the coupling of phenol and which of the following compound? Correct Answer Diazonium chloride

The most widely practiced reaction of diazonium salts is azo coupling. In this process, the diazonium compound is attacked by, i.e., coupled to, electron-rich substrates. When the coupling partners are arenes such as anilines and phenols, the process is an example of electrophilic aromatic substitution.
